Welcome to the 2009 NCAA® Division II Championship Volleyball Tournament website. The website will be operated by the Concordia University sports information staff throughout the tournament, and will be kept up-to-date with scores, schedules, official stats, recaps, and quotes following each match.
Tickets are $15.00 for adults, $10.00 for seniors, $5.00 for students and free for children five years of age and under. Tickets are purchased for the entire day, allowing ticket holders access to each match of the day the ticket was purchased. There are no advance ticket sales, all tickets will be purchased same-day, at the Gangelhoff Center Front Desk. The arena will be open one hour prior to the first match of each day. No season passes will be honored.
